[23] high chair ingenuity 3 in 1http://stbartsestes.org/questions-and-interesting-facts/faq-when-did-the-apostle-john-get-off-the-island-of-patmos.html high chair insertEarly tradition says that John was banished to Patmos by the Roman authorities. This tradition is credible because banishment was a common punishment used during the Imperial period for a number of offenses. Among such offenses were the practices of magic and astrology.
